PDA

View Full Version : آموزش نصب g++ بر روی galaxy tab



FastCode
چهارشنبه 24 فروردین 1390, 17:11 عصر
سلام.
این کار رو خودم ۴ بار انجام دادم و کار کرده.(۳ بار رام آسیا و یک بار رام اوروپا)

http://www.gphone.org.hk/cgi-bin/ch/threaded_show.cgi?tid=69&pid=222&h=1
apt-get install g++ gcc
خط بالا برای این بود که بتونم این پست رو در این سایت بدم.(و اسم تاپیک مشکل قانونی نداشته باشه)
اگر سوالی دارید بپرسید.

من خودم هر ۴ دفعه رو با ssh انجام دادم و از adb استفاده نکردم.
اگر کسی از adb استفاده کرده به من یک pm بده که بفهمیم فرقش چیه.

الان من gcc و perl و apache و php و mysql-client و ..(و ۳۰ ۴۰ تا چیز دیگه).. روی گوشیم دارم:قلب:

mahdi68
چهارشنبه 24 فروردین 1390, 18:14 عصر
سلام
آیا اول Debian رو گالاکسی تب نصب کردید بعد G++ , ... روی اون نصب کردید یا اون لینکی که گذاشتید اشتباهه ؟

FastCode
چهارشنبه 24 فروردین 1390, 19:48 عصر
جواب سوالتون

apt-get install g++ gcc
خط بالا برای این بود که بتونم این پست رو در این سایت بدم.(و اسم تاپیک مشکل قانونی نداشته باشه)
علت اصلی
راستش من چند هفته دنبال این میگشتم که چطوری روی گلکسی c++ کامپایل کنم.
یک راهش ubuntu بود یک راه هم دبیان.ubuntu زیاد حافظه میگیره و سنگینتره.برای همین از debian استفاده کردم و چون با سیستم لپتاپم یکیه خیلی راحتم.
این هم در واقع یک دبیان کامل نیست.خیلی از بخشها رو نداره و از هسته android استفاده میکنه.

FastCode
شنبه 17 دی 1390, 12:34 عصر
این تاپیک رو میارم بالا تا بقیه کاراییهاش رو نمایش بدم:
Screenshot:
80332

اگر مراحل بالا رو انجام داده باشید یه شل دارید.
ولی Desktop توی عکس خیلی باحالتر از شل ه.:کف:خییییلی
apt-get install gnome
دستوری نیست که اجراش کنید و جواب بده.
چند تا مشکل اساسی سر ه راهه.
۱.فضای خالی درون ایمیجش خیلی کمه.
۲.با چی میخواهید تصویر رو ببینید.
۳.صفحه کلید ندارید.
۴.واقعاً brasero لازمه؟(من که فکر نمیکنم)
اول باید e2fsprogs رو نصب کنید.
بعد یک عدد microSD ه 8 GiB ناقابل رو که پارتیشن بندی نشده وارد دستگاه میکنید.(قراره فرمت بشه./عکساتون نپره)


#use connectbot
#enter these commands in the previously installed debian shell

cd /mnt/dev/block
mkfs.ext2 -vL "Debian" mmcblk1
cd /mnt/sdcard
mkdir deb_new
mount /mnt/dev/block/mmcblk1 deb_new
cp -Rx / deb_new
umount /mnt/dev/block/mmcblk1
cd /mnt/data/local
cp setupdeb.sh /mnt/sdcard/setupdeb.sh.bak
cat setupdeb.sh
dd if=setupdeb.sh count=40

export kit=/dev/block/mmcblk1
export mnt=/data/local/mnt
export TERM=linux
export HOME=/root
export PATH=$bin:/usr/bin:/usr/sbin:/bin:$PATH
busybox clear
busybox mkdir -p $mnt

busybox mount $kit $mnt

busybox mount -t devpts devpts $mnt/dev/pts
busybox mount -t proc proc $mnt/proc
busybox mount -t sysfs sysfs $mnt/sys

busybox mkdir -p $mnt/mnt
busybox mkdir -p $mnt/mnt/sdcard $mnt/mnt/system
busybox mkdir -p $mnt/mnt/data $mnt/mnt/dev

busybox mount -o bind /sdcard $mnt/mnt/sdcard
busybox mount -o bind /system $mnt/mnt/system
busybox mount -o bind /data $mnt/mnt/data
busybox mount -o bind /dev $mnt/mnt/dev
busybox mount -t tmpfs tmpfs $mnt/tmp -o noatime,mode=1777
echo "entering debian..."
busybox chroot $mnt /bin/bash
#After exit command is executed clear it all up
echo " "
echo "Shutting down Debian........"
cd /
umount $mnt/dev/pts
umount $mnt/proc
umount $mnt/sys
umount $mnt/mnt/sdcard
umount $mnt/mnt/system
umount $mnt/mnt/data
umount $mnt/mnt/dev
umount $mnt/tmp
umount $mnt/usr
umount $mnt




#press enter here till it`s done.
#wait at least ten minutes and then
#reboot device.you really don't want to loose all the work
#go to debian shell again



apt-get install gnome gdm3 tightvncserver matchbox-keyboard

mkdir $HOME/.Xresources
cd /root
cd .vnc
dd of=xstartup count=7
#!/bin/sh
xrdb $HOME/.Xresources
xsetroot -solid grey
gdm3 &
export XKL_XMODMAP_DISABLE=1
gnome-session



#enter these lines at wish
apt-get install aptitude eclipse codelite geany gcc transmission
apt-get install wxmaxima openoffice.org ghex ffmpeg baobab
apt-get install gimp wireshark htop gitg ptunnel stunnel4 synaptic jcal
مشکلات
xvkbd فقط با lxde کار میکنه
mysqlserver درست کار نمیکنه
صدا رو اصلاً دوست ندارید آزمایش کنید.(دستگاه خاموش میشه)
بلوتوث کار نمیکنه
blender رو آزمایش نکنید.(3D render روی گوشی:گیج:)
qemu مشکل focus داره.(freebsd و debian رو نسبتاً خوب بالا آورد)

برای دیدن تصویر tightvncviewer مخصوص اندروید رو از code.google.com بگیرید.

اگر کاربر لینوکس هستید حتماً بخش Appendix این صفحه رو بخونید:
http://wiki.debian.org/QemuUserEmulation